Twenty-three stories of the history of early Oregon plus an appendix: A Brief Summary Of The History Of The Old Oregon Country From Original Sources. OLD OREGON was a mighty sweep of country, and a most romantic one. From the northern border of Mexican California to near Sitka in Russian America it stretched, nearly eight hundred miles. Eastward it stretched over a country of mighty mountain … until the limits of the Oregon country, at the crest of the main range of the Rockies…. The romance ever lingers…. I have given four years of devoted study to Oregon history, three of them among the special collections of the Northwest, and over a year in London. In England I had full access to the documents of the Public Record Office, including unpublished accounts of the various explorations, and also, what was a far rarer privilege, access to the journals, diaries, and letters of the Hudson's Bay Company. Simple as this book is, every statement is based on original authority. Comment on the British and American claims to the country is founded entirely upon sources. These sources include journals written by fur-traders In the mountains and on the march, private letters between themselves, official reports of chief factors to their Company in London, diplomatic correspondence of American and English diplomats, and published works, in original editions, of exploration and discovery. It has been my aim to make this volume a clear, straightforward account of the romantic discovery and settlement of Old Oregon…( Author's Preface and david wales)
